- The global solar photovoltaic (PV) panels market size was valued at USD 152.53 billion in 2025 and is expected to reach USD 215.27 billion by 2033, at a CAGR of 4.40% during the forecast period

Solar Photovoltaic (PV) panels are categorized into different types based on the materials used in their construction. The market is segmented by type into crystalline silicon PV panels and thin-film PV panels. Crystalline silicon panels are currently the most commonly used type of solar panels due to their efficiency and reliability. On the other hand, thin-film PV panels are known for their flexibility and lightweight nature, making them suitable for certain applications where traditional panels may not be feasible. In terms of end-use, the market is segmented into residential, commercial, industrial, and utility sectors. The residential sector is witnessing significant growth due to the increasing adoption of solar panels by homeowners looking to reduce their carbon footprint and energy costs. The commercial and industrial sectors are also embracing solar PV panels to meet sustainability goals and lower their operational expenses. Additionally, utility-scale solar projects are gaining traction as governments and energy companies invest in large solar farms to meet renewable energy targets.

The global solar photovoltaic (PV) panels market is witnessing significant growth driven by several key factors such as increasing awareness about renewable energy sources, government initiatives promoting solar energy adoption, technological advancements in panel efficiency, and decreasing costs of solar power generation. One of the emerging trends in the market is the growing popularity of building-integrated photovoltaics (BIPV), where solar panels are integrated into the building structure itself, providing dual functionality of generating electricity and serving as building materials. This trend is being fueled by the construction industry's increasing focus on sustainable and energy-efficient building solutions.
Moreover, the market is also witnessing a shift towards solar panel recycling and sustainability practices as the industry aims to reduce its environmental footprint and manage end-of-life solar panels responsibly. Companies are increasingly investing in research and development activities to enhance the recyclability of solar panels and reduce the environmental impact associated with their disposal. This focus on sustainability is not only driven by regulatory pressures but also by consumer demand for eco-friendly products and services.
Furthermore, the market is experiencing increased competition among solar panel manufacturers, leading to advancements in panel technology, increased production capacities, and improved cost efficiencies. Companies are focusing on developing next-generation solar panels with higher conversion efficiencies, better durability, and lower manufacturing costs to stay competitive in the market. This competition is resulting in a broader range of product offerings, including customized solutions for specific end-user requirements and applications.
Another significant aspect impacting the solar PV panels market is the growing integration of solar energy storage solutions such as batteries. Energy storage technologies enable the efficient management of solar power generation, allowing consumers to store excess energy for later use or during periods of low sunlight. This trend is particularly relevant for residential and commercial sectors looking to enhance energy self-sufficiency and reduce dependency on the grid. The integration of energy storage solutions with solar PV panels is expected to drive further market growth and adoption in the coming years.
